Secret Features to Consider
Before acquiring a treadmill, buyers must evaluate numerous vital technical specs to guarantee the maker matches their fitness objectives and living space.
1. Motor Power (CHP)
Continuous Horsepower (CHP) determines the power output of the motor over sustained durations.
- 1.5 to 2.0 CHP: Ideal for strolling and light jogging for users of average weight.
- 2.0 to 3.0 CHP: Suitable for routine joggers and households with numerous users.
- 3.0+ CHP: Essential for serious runners, heavy daily use, and period training.
2. Running Deck Size
The belt measurements determine how comfortably a user can move.
- Width: Standard widths vary from 20 to 22 inches. Larger belts provide a higher margin of mistake for runners.
- Length: Walkers can get by with a 45-to-50-inch belt, however anybody over 5 feet 8 inches or anybody who runs ought to look for a deck length of at least 55 to 60 inches.
3. Cushioning Systems
Outdoor working on asphalt locations substantial stress on joints. Quality home treadmills include shock absorption decks that reduce effect by approximately 15% to 30% compared to roadway running, protecting the knees, ankles, and hips.
4. Slope and Decline Capabilities
Slope includes variety and strength, imitating uphill outside running and burning significantly more calories. Numerous modern treadmills offer motorized slopes ranging from 0% to 15%, while premium designs also use decline abilities to imitate downhill running.

Merely owning a treadmill does not ensure results. To get the most out of every session, keep these finest practices in mind:
- Vary Your Routine: Avoid dullness and plateaus by including interval training. Alternate between high-speed sprints and active recovery strolls.
- Utilize Incline: Even a 1% or 2% incline assists simulate outside wind resistance and engages posterior chain muscles more effectively.
- Keep Proper Form: Keep your head up, shoulders relaxed, and core engaged. Prevent holding onto the hand rails unless necessary, as it lowers calorie burn and alters natural biomechanics.
- Prioritize Maintenance: Vacuum dust from around the motor real estate monthly, and oil the running belt according to the maker's instructions (usually every 3 to 6 months) to lengthen the life of the machine.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)How much space do I need for a home treadmill?
The majority of standard treadmills need a footprint of roughly 7 feet long by 3 feet wide when in use. Furthermore, you must leave at least 2 feet of clearance on either side and 3 to 6 feet of clearance behind the device for security. If space is tight, search for hydraulic folding designs.
Do I need a subscription to use a wise treadmill?
Many modern-day treadmills include big touchscreens that need a regular monthly membership (such as iFit or Peloton) to gain access to live and on-demand classes. Nevertheless, nearly all of these devices use a "Manual Mode" or standard integrated programs that can be used without an active membership.
How typically should I oil the treadmill belt?
As a general guideline, you ought to examine and oil your treadmill belt every 3 to 6 months, or after every 130 to 150 miles of use. Constantly consult your user handbook, as utilizing the wrong kind of lube (such as basic WD-40) can ruin the belt and deck.
Are manual treadmills any excellent?
Non-motorized manual discount treadmills rely totally on your own power to move the belt. They are typically less expensive, need no electricity, and are wonderful for high-intensity period training (HIIT). Nevertheless, they can be physically demanding and are normally not fit for casual, steady-state walking or jogging.
